Question 8
Structuring a table in relational database. In each statement select
True or False.
Each item will receive partial credit for each correct selection.
Each value in a field in a table must be unique - False
Each row in a table must be unique - True
Each column name in a table must be unique – True

Question 37
Instructions: For each of the following statements, select True if
the statement is true. Otherwise, select False. Each correct
selection is worth a partial point.
A full database backup is a copy of all the data in the entire
database – True
A transaction log backup backs up all the data in the database –
False
A differential backup copies only data that was changed before the
last full backup – False
A file or filegroup restore specified a portion of the database to
recover – True
